OCONTO FALLS, WI- The Oconto Falls Police Department and the Oconto County Sheriff’s Office responded to an incident involving a Law Enforcement Officer that sustained a gunshot
wound.
The incident occurred in the City of Oconto Falls on the 100 block of Elm Avenue on Friday around 10:30am.
The response was due to several 911 hang up calls.
“We believe it was a suspicious activity or a kidnapping type incident is what it came in as, and that is the information that the officer was prepared to respond to,” said Oconto County Sheriff Todd Skarban.
Upon arrival an Oconto Falls Police Officer made contact with the caller. The Oconto County Emergency Dispatch Center was notified of the Officer sustaining a gunshot wound.
Several agencies responded to the scene, including the Oconto County Sheriff’s Office, Wisconsin State Patrol, Gillett Police Department, Oconto Police Department, Oconto County Emergency Management and the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ources.
The suspect, a 29 year old female from Oconto Falls, was arrested and transported to the Oconto County
Jail and charges of First Degree Attempted Homicide will being referred to the Oconto County District
Attorney. The wounded Officer was transported to a Green Bay Area Hospital and is now in stable condition.
Sheriff Skarban says the incident was an isolated and there is no further threat to the public.
The matter is currently under investigation by the Wisconsin Department of Criminal Investigation and the Oconto County Sheriff’s Office.
The officer is said to have been with the Oconto Falls Police Department for two years and had prior law enforcement experience.
“We hope for a speedy recovery. God was on our side today.”
“When you are in the fight, you win the fight and that is what we are trained to do,” Skarban said. “You are going to go home to your family.”
“The support that we receive from our community is second to none.”
